KMPR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2015 in Review
151 of the 3,590 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Kemper (KMPR) for Q3 2015, worth a combined $995M — down 8.7% from $1.09B a quarter earlier.
Sellers outnumbered buyers: 12 funds closed out of KMPR and 10 opened new positions — a net loss of 2 holders — while 59 trimmed existing stakes and 47 added.
The largest buyer was Capital Research Global Investors, adding an estimated $27.2M. The largest seller was T. Rowe Price Associates, cutting an estimated $7.4M.
